The MNs communicate with the APs through the protocol defined by the 802.11 standard. LWAPP APs, upon bootup, discover and join one of the controllers and the controller pushes the configuration, that includes the WLAN parameters, to the LWAPP APs. The APs then encapsulate all the 802.11 frames from wireless clients inside LWAPP frames and forward the LWAPP frames to the controller. GLOSSARY Access Point ( AP ) An entity that contains an 802.11 medium access control ( MAC ) and physical layer ( PHY ) interface and provides access to the distribution services via the wireless medium for associated clients. LWAPP APs encapsulate all the 802.11 frames in LWAPP frames and sends them to the controller to which it is logically connected. Light Weight Access Point Protocol ( LWAPP ) This is a generic protocol that defines the communication between the Access Points and the Central Controller. Mobile Node ( MN ) A roaming 802.11 wireless device in a wireless network associated with an access point. Mobile Node, Mobile Station(Ms) and client are used interchangeably. Wireless local-area network ( WLAN ) A local-area network that uses high-frequency radio waves rather than wires to communicate between nodes. Workgroup Bridge ( WGB ) A WGB can provide a wireless infrastructure connection for a Ethernet-enabled devices. Devices that do not have a wireless client adapter in order to connect to the wireless network can be connected to a WGB through Ethernet port.
